Very happy to be back at Next Level again for The Artefact, currently their highest-rated room on Morty, though somehow inexplicably was not one of the several Next Level rooms nominated for TERPECA this year. As usual, the GM played a significant role as an AI with jokes and funny one-liners, adding a lot of levity to the experience along with some humorous situations. Despite its space limitations (underground level of an office building), Next Level did a good job with the theming, offering a few very differently decorated areas that combined mostly hi-tech puzzles with only a handful of padlocks/keypads.
The puzzles were challenging but not overly difficult, and despite struggling early we hit our stride and finished the room with 20 minutes to spare. It's a room where teamwork is necessary and important, and having four players definitely made things a lot easier. I would say everything in the Artefact was very solid — the theming, the creativity, the puzzles, and the flow ticked all the boxes — but nothing in particular really wowed us. On the whole, we had fun once again, and we look forward to tackling End of the Road next time.
